When the ice that he is sleeping on breaks up and floats away, Little Fox is accidentally transported to an island. As he explores his new home, he meets seabirds and fur seals and learns about their lives. Written and illustrated by a field biologist with years of experience in the Alaskan wilderness, "The Little Fox" introduces young readers to the animals of the Bering Sea - the sounds they make, their unusual appearance, and their methods of surviving the short, intense arctic summer.
